Bafana v Egypt in Gauteng

2011-03-08 16:04
Johannesburg - The eagerly awaited March 26 Africa Cup of Nations 2012 qualifier between Bafana Bafana and Egypt will be played in Gauteng, reports the Sowetan

"We are busy finalising the contract for the match but I can tell you that it will be played here in Gauteng," said acting SAFA chief executive Pinky Lehoko.

This ends speculation that the match was heading for either Peter Mokaba Stadium in Polokwane or Royal Bafokeng Sports Palace in Rustenburg.

Sowetan has learnt that representatives from the Polokwane municipality approached SAFA last week with a view to hosting the match. They will also host the 2011 African Champions League match between Egyptian giants Al-Ahly and SuperSport United on April 2.

SAFA decided to look for an alternative venue after many people expressed concerns about the condition of the pitch at Soccer City, the original venue for the fixture.

Stadium Management South Africa, which is managing the stadium, has assured SAFA that the pitch will be in good condition for the Bafana match.
